High speed cable assembly is an additional location where careful design is crucial. As data prices increase and systems become much more advanced, cords must be able to send signals with minimal loss, interference, and latency. Whether utilized in industrial control systems, AI server infrastructure, or medical imaging gadgets, broadband cable settings up require controlled resistance, solid securing, and precise discontinuation strategies. A badly created assembly can present crosstalk, depletion, or electromagnetic interference, all of which can reduce system performance. This is particularly important in environments where exact and uninterrupted interaction is essential, such as in AI server cable assembly applications. In these data-intensive systems, secure power distribution and high-speed signal transmission have to exist side-by-side within thick and commonly thermally difficult devices enclosures. A properly designed cable assembly aids keep computing efficiency, decrease service interruptions, and support the ever-growing needs of modern-day electronic framework.

Control cabinet harnesses stand for one more important classification in commercial and industrial equipment. Control closets commonly house power distribution, automation controllers, relays, terminal blocks, and communication components, all within a small enclosure. The electrical wiring inside must be meticulously organized and plainly identified to ensure risk-free operation and effective servicing since room is limited. A control cabinet harness aids streamline this complexity by consolidating interior circuitry into a well-engineered bundle that lowers clutter and supports regular build high quality. This technique can additionally improve airflow within the cabinet, decrease installment time, and boost electrical security. The increase of electric vehicles has created strong need for EV high voltage cable settings up and EV high voltage harness solutions. These parts need to safely lug substantial electric loads while sustaining temperature level changes, resonance, wetness, and mechanical tension. High voltage harnesses call for special attention to insulation, protecting, connector compatibility, and routing to lower the risk of arcing or electric leakage. Safety and security is critical in EV systems, so the design and production process have to represent governing requirements, efficiency testing, and long-lasting integrity. The same is real for data center power cable systems, which need to sustain constant power distribution to servers, networking equipment, and storage space systems. As data centers proceed to increase in range and power density, trustworthy power line settings up come to be increasingly crucial for functional resilience. A data center power cable need to not only perform electricity efficiently however additionally maintain thermal performance and mechanical stability in atmospheres with limited room restraints and high equipment loads.

Medical device cable assembly applications call for a specifically high degree of precision and quality control. Medical equipment often runs in delicate environments where patient safety, analysis precision, and device reliability are essential. Wires utilized in surgical tools, imaging systems, tracking tools, and analysis systems must fulfill strict criteria for tidiness, biocompatibility, durability, and versatility. In many cases, cords must additionally support repetitive sanitation, regular handling, or activity during active usage. A medical device cable assembly service provider need to pay very close attention to material selection, producing uniformity, and screening procedures to make sure each assembly executes as intended. Waterproof connector production is one more important variable in building durable cable and harness services. Many applications reveal wiring to dampness, dust, chemicals, or exterior weather, every one of which can degrade electric performance if the link points are not appropriately secured. A waterproof connector manufacturer designs options that preserve electric integrity while securing out pollutants. This is specifically essential in aquatic equipment, outside automation, farming machinery, and EV systems, where direct exposure to challenging atmospheres prevails. A custom connector manufacturer adds additional worth by adapting the connector interface to the details electrical, mechanical, and area needs of the item. Custom connectors can enhance compatibility, reduce assembly complexity, and produce even more reputable interfaces between subsystems. Engineering wire harness design is the bridge between principle and production. Strong engineering wire harness design takes into consideration conductor sizing, voltage drop, thermal habits, bend span, EMI defense, connector positioning, assembly sequence, and use. A flexible robot cable harness have to be designed in a different way from a control cabinet harness or an EV high voltage harness due to the fact that each one encounters unique tension patterns and functional needs.
